Can the Volkswagen T-Roc use 92 octane gasoline?
1 Answers
The Volkswagen T-Roc cannot use 92 octane gasoline; this vehicle requires 95 octane gasoline. The T-Roc is equipped with turbocharged engines across all models, and using 92 octane gasoline may cause engine knocking. Compared to 92 octane gasoline, 95 octane gasoline has better anti-knock performance. The anti-knock performance of gasoline refers to its ability to resist knocking during combustion in the engine. The Volkswagen T-Roc is a compact SUV with body dimensions of 4318mm in length, 1819mm in width, and 1582mm in height, with a wheelbase of 2680mm. The vehicle is equipped with three engines in total: a 1.2-liter turbocharged engine, a low-power version of the 1.4-liter turbocharged engine, and a high-power version of the 1.4-liter turbocharged engine.
